![( A ) Analysis of Siglec-engaging sialoglycans using HYDRA immunohistochemistry in a <t>TMA</t> comprising <t>51</t> <t>prostate</t> tissue samples shows ligands for Siglec-3 (unpaired t test, p=0.0216), Siglec-7 (unpaired t test, p=0.0143) and Siglec-9 (unpaired t test, p=0.0271) are upregulated in prostate tumour tissue relative to normal prostate tissue. ( B ) Staining a previously published 96 case TMA [ , ] containing 17 normal prostate tissue samples and 79 samples of prostate tumour tissue showed that sialoglycan ligands for Siglec-3 (unpaired t test, p<0.001), Siglec-7 (unpaired t test, p<0.0001) and Siglec-9 (unpaired t test, p0.0171) are found at significantly higher levels in prostate tumours compared to normal prostate tissues. ( C ) HYDRA immunohistochemistry analysis of Siglec-3, -7 and -9 ligands in a previously published 200 case TMA [ , ] containing matched tumour and normal tissues from the same patient. Sialoglycan ligands recognised by Siglec-3 (paired t test, p<0.0001), Siglec-7 (paired t test, p=0.0003) and Siglec-9 (p<0.0001) are significantly increased in prostate cancer tissue relative to matched normal tissue from the same patient.
